Understanding the grand jury complaint process
The civil grand jury is an essential component of local governance, serving a critical role in the oversight of government operations and ensuring accountability within public agencies. Unlike criminal grand juries that focus on indictments, civil grand juries investigate the performance of public entities and may recommend reforms for improvement. Their function is not merely advisory; they have the power to conduct investigations and expose issues affecting the community.
Submitting a complaint to the civil grand jury is significant. It helps hold public officials accountable for their actions and decisions, emphasizing transparency within local government. Complaints can range from allegations of misconduct to concerns over the ineffectiveness of public services. Understanding the legal framework that guides these complaints is crucial as it empowers citizens to participate actively in the democratic process.
The grand jury complaint form: A detailed overview
The civil grand jury complaint form is a structured document that facilitates the submission of complaints, ensuring that all necessary information is presented clearly. The form typically includes several sections—each designed to collect specific information from the complainant. This allows the grand jury to evaluate the complaint effectively and determine the course of action.
Essential sections in the complaint form include personal information about the complainant, a detailed description of the complaint, and the specific resolution sought. It’s important to understand key terms present in the form as they establish the framework for the complaint, with terms like 'complainant' referring to the individual filing the complaint, 'respondent' being the government entity or official in question, and 'jurisdiction' defining the authority of the civil grand jury to investigate the matter.
Step-by-step instructions for filling out the complaint form
Filling out the civil grand jury complaint form accurately is crucial for ensuring a successful submission. Start by gathering all required information, which typically includes your name, contact information, and details of the specific issue you are addressing. It is essential to compile any evidence or supporting documents that can reinforce your claims, as these can significantly impact the grand jury's review process.
Each section of the form must be completed diligently. For instance, Section 1 asks for basic information about the complainant, while Section 2 requires a thorough description of the events or matters that led to the complaint. Section 3 should clearly outline what resolution you are seeking from the grand jury. Lastly, ensure that you sign and date the form in Section 4, as an unsigned complaint may be dismissed.
Common mistakes include failing to sign the form, which can lead to immediate rejection, or providing incomplete information, which may necessitate follow-up inquiries. It’s vital to review the completed form thoroughly before submission.

Submitting your complaint: Best practices
Once your civil grand jury complaint form is completed and signed, the next step is submission. Identifying the correct grand jury office is crucial to ensure that your complaint reaches the right authority. This can vary by jurisdiction, so double-check the local regulations to determine where to send your document.
Additionally, you may choose between physical and electronic submissions—both methods have their pros and cons. Electronic submissions may provide faster processing times, while physical copies allow for a tangible record. After submitting the complaint, it's essential to establish a follow-up procedure. You should inquire about the status of your complaint, preparing for any follow-up interviews or requests from the grand jury as they may need clarification or additional information.
